- 博客(20)
- 收藏
- 关注
原创 2021-07-29
分享一个RedisTemplate自定义序列化配置主要针对于<String, Object>的,其他情况可以做参考用package com.example.demo.config;import com.fasterxml.jackson.annotation.JsonAutoDetect;import com.fasterxml.jackson.annotation.PropertyAccessor;import com.fasterxml.jackson.databind.Obje
2021-07-29 17:19:18
176
原创 2021-07-24
SpringCloud 无冲突pom.xml在做springcloud练习,有被jar冲突的问题恶心到,经过多方面查找与测试,整理出一套无冲突pom依赖,作为学习使用应该是足够了。``<?xml version="1.0" encoding="UTF-8"?>4.0.0<groupId>org.example</groupId><artifactId>cloud</artifactId><packaging>pom<
2021-07-24 18:36:13
167
原创 控制滚动条定位到错误入力框
var screenHeight= window.screen.height;var res = $(’.field.error’)[0].getBoundingClientRect();var top = document.scrollingElement.scrollTop + res.y;$(document.scrollingElement).scrollTop(top - screenHeight / 2);
2021-06-08 15:15:43
158
原创 BeanUtils.copyProperties忽略null方法
常用于拷贝DTO对象属性到实体类,实体类中部分字段有设置默认值,即可以不将DTO中的空值拷贝过来,保持原有默认值BeanUtils.copyProperties(source, target, getNullPropertyNames(source));可以将下面的方法做成一个Util使用, source会忽略null值复制到target中public static String[] getNullPropertyNames(Object source) { final BeanWr
2020-10-16 15:26:03
2189
1
原创 notepad++ 正则表达式:在大写字母前面加“_”或空格
helloWorldfind:(.)([A-Z])replace:\1_\2hello_World如果是加空格:replace:\1 \2在\1与\2之间添加一个空格即可正则解释: (.)用来匹配任意字符,([A-Z])匹配大写字母
2020-10-14 09:00:57
1878
1
原创 记录一下python爬虫+demo,免得忘记了
记录一下python爬虫demo只有爬取数据和存入EXCEL的功能。from urllib import requestimport refrom xlwt import *需要以上三个依赖。from urllib import request :模拟发送请求import re :正则from xlwt import * :wt意味着write 写出,用...
2019-12-13 13:29:28
203
原创 python3.0 爬虫示例(目标58)
#coding:utf-8‘’’’’@author: jsjxy‘’’import urllib.requestfrom bs4 import BeautifulSoupfrom openpyxl import workbook # 写入Excel表所用from openpyxl import load_workbook # 读取Excel表所用import osos.chd...
2019-07-30 16:04:36
303
原创 esayui 动态网格+分页
效果图这里只做了两条数据作为演示。引入esayui就不多说了。field: 对应字段名就可以。把我们的数据源处理成上图格式,total的值是数据总数,默认分页每页10条。返回给页面即可。...
2019-01-02 20:16:44
266
原创 oracle学习记录(三)声明数组及多维数组
定义了一个类型为 number 并且长度为11的数组,赋值为0、1、2、3、4….10输出效果如下图 多维数组需要先声明第二维度的类型以及数量 需要有一个维度嵌套的概念 声明第一维度数组的时候,将他的类型声明为第二维度的类型 如:Route_Rec_Type 格式是固定的。 输出效果如下图: ...
2018-09-26 08:41:02
2062
原创 oracle学习记录(一)存储过程
使用PLSQL工具 首先了解包的概念,类似于JAVA中的类(Class) 一个包中可以有很多个存储过程,存储过程类似JAVA中的方法函数 不过这里的包分为包头与包体 包头做声明,包体做具体实现。 类似JAVA中的接口与实现类 存储过程的具体实现需要按照oracle的规范写 在is与begin之间声明参数...
2018-09-26 08:40:08
225
原创 roacle学习记录(二)循环
首先看一下硬循环 效果等同于 for(i=1;i&lt;=10;i++){ system.out.println(i); } 然后看一下利用游标循环遍历出表R50中所有数据 表中有多少条数据,就循环多少次。 是不是有些类似JAVA中的迭代器遍历? while (iterator.hasNext()){ System.out.println(...
2018-09-26 08:35:56
287
原创 Servlet生命周期理解
Servlet生命周期说的便是Servlet从诞生直至消亡的整个过程。 Servlet生命周期分为四个阶段: (一)初始化 init() 在Servlet的整个生命周期中 初始化inti()方法 只会被调用一次, 之后无论多少次请求都不会再执行init()方法。而init()方法在什么时候被调用呢? 其实初始化方法有两种执行时机。 1、在Servlet服务器启动的时候直接给予初始化...
2018-09-17 10:14:00
248
原创 关于Springboot 读取不到application.yml配置文件的解决方法
在pom中添加依赖 <dependency> <groupId>org.yaml</groupId> <artifactId>snakeyaml</artifactId> <version>${snakeyaml.version}<...
2018-09-06 16:15:45
11772
1
原创 Springboot整合MySQL(排雷日记 二)
所有结构都搞定了,实体类、接口、控制器 但是运行的时候报错。 大概意思是说我的实体类有什么问题 创建 bean的时候出了啥状况吧。 然后在网上找了一些前辈的资料。org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'entityManagerFactory' d...
2018-08-31 10:58:56
220
原创 Springboot整合MySQL(排雷日记)
搭建好项目,进入JPA、WEB、MySQL。 install的时候一直报错[ERROR] Failed to execute goal org.apache.maven.plugins:maven-surefire-plugin:2.21.0:test (default-test) on project demo4: There are test failures.[ERROR] [ER...
2018-08-31 09:57:06
2637
原创 Springboot整合jsp
一:引入依赖 <!--我们先来添加jsp的maven支持--> <dependency> <groupId>org.apache.tomcat.embed</groupId> <artifactId>tomcat-embed-jasper</artif...
2018-08-28 10:29:28
276
原创 Springboot 发送一个get请求
在这样一个代码块中,很清晰的看到在@RequestMapping中声明了请求方法为GET,在@RequestParam(value=”userName”)中可以看到,我们把请求参数的名字设置为userName@RestControllerpublic class HelloController {@RequestMapping(value="/hello",method= Request...
2018-08-27 11:41:57
2724
原创 idea springboot实现热部署
首先在pom.xml中添加依赖 <!-- 热部署模块 --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-devtools</artifactId> <optional>
2018-08-27 09:27:54
183
转载 存储过程(资料整理)
存储过程是SQL 语句和可选控制流语句的预编译集合,以一个名称存储并作为一个单元处理。存储过程存储在数据库内,可由应用程序通过一个调用执行,而且允许用户声明变量、有条件执行以及其它强大的编程功能。存储过程在创建时即在服务器上进行编译,所以执行起来比单个SQL语句快。1.存储过程只在创造时进行编译,以后每次执行存储过程都不需再重新编译,而一般SQL语句每执行一次就编译一次,所以使用存储过程可提高...
2018-08-24 10:05:36
413
原创 Flashback Qurey(闪回查询) oracle数据库数据恢复
今天由于错误操作,但是数据库代码丢了几千行。 菊花一紧,冷汗直流。 关键时刻张茂林与倪闻伯,脚踏七色祥云,犹如盖世英雄 SELECT * FROM dba_source AS OF TIMESTAMP TO_TIMESTAMP (‘2018-08-23 08:00:00’, ‘YYYY-MM-DD HH24:MI:SS’) WHERE owner=’OLP’ and name =’PK...
2018-08-23 16:05:00
247
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人